My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Taz - short for Tasmanian Tiger. 14LBS and born in DEC 2021 and has a Pedigree. He is potty trained. Great with other dogs. No cats.

Taz looks like the now-extinct Tasmanian Tiger. Or a red fox. Or somewhere between. One thing is for sure, he is a charming, clever dog. Owner surrender by a breeder. He is a lot of fun and will attach to his people and has a demeanor of a cat. If you know Shiba Inu, you will love him. What he does have is the lean, expressive face of a thinking dog. Loves to go at Doggie daycare and is the star there. Great on the leash as well, loves those walks.
Takes food or treats gently from your hand. You can pat his head, scratch his ears etc.. Fine riding in a car.
Friendly with other dogs and submissive. He is Puppy who needs a great home!!! His adoption fee is $600 which includes all vetting and neutering.
